Lady Lancer Land in Torrington is a good place to be today with official results posted for the first half of the Central Rocky Mountain Region rodeo season. Eastern Wyoming College women are #1 at the winter break led by Jacey Thompson. The sophomore from a very big rodeo family in Yoder, WY won the all-around race by a large margin at the final fall event held in Cheyenne. Thompson posted huge numbers with a goat tying victory and first-place split in breakaway roping and is the top all-around cowgirl in the entire region. She is the first to note the important contributions of teammate Karissa Rayhill who won the first round of goat tying in Cheyenne and earned points breakaway roping as well. EWC Coach Jake Clark's Thompson/Rayhill combo accounted for 510 points in Cheyenne last weekend to win the event.
